Sundal

Expert Snapshot

Sundal, a traditional vegetarian dish from Puducherry, encapsulates the essence of local culinary heritage through its unique ingredients and preparation methods. Renowned for its vibrant flavors, this dish serves as a cultural emblem and a staple in the bustling breakfast stalls of Pondicherry.

Masterclass Preparation

The preparation of Sundal is a meticulous process that highlights the connection between the ingredients and the local environment. Begin by soaking the chickpeas overnight; this is essential as the hard water of Pondicherry requires an extra pinch of soda to soften the legumes. The soaking not only hydrates the chickpeas but also initiates enzymatic reactions that enhance flavor and texture.

Next, drain the chickpeas and steam them until tender; this method preserves their nutrients while ensuring a pleasant bite. The use of unpolished clay vessels during steaming is crucial, as they allow for moisture-wicking and impart a subtle earthy flavor to the dish.

In a separate pan, heat sesame oil and add mustard seeds, allowing them to crackle, which releases essential oils that contribute to the dish's aroma. The addition of green chilies and curry leaves at this stage creates a fragrant base, while the asafetida brings out the umami notes and aids digestion.

Once the spices are aromatic, incorporate the steamed chickpeas and mix thoroughly. The combination of ingredients not only balances flavor but also ensures a harmonious pH level, enhancing the overall taste profile. Finally, fold in the freshly grated coconut, which adds sweetness and moisture, completing the dish.

Authentic Serving Suggestions

Pondicherry locals often present Sundal in terracotta or brass vessels, which not only enhance the dish's flavor but also maintain its temperature. Garnish with a sprinkle of fresh coconut and a few additional curry leaves for an inviting visual appeal. Traditionally served as a snack or part of a meal, Sundal pairs beautifully with a cup of filter coffee, a local favorite that complements its savory profile.

During festivals, it is common to see Sundal offered as prasad (sacred offering) in temples, reinforcing its significance within local rituals and celebrations.

FAQ Section

What is the best method to soak chickpeas for Sundal?

Soak the chickpeas overnight in ample water, adding a pinch of baking soda to aid in softening due to the hard water in Pondicherry. This ensures even cooking and enhances the texture of the chickpeas.

Can I use canned chickpeas instead of dried ones?

Yes, but for authentic flavor and texture, it is recommended to use dried chickpeas. If using canned, ensure they are rinsed thoroughly to remove excess sodium and preservatives.

How can I enhance the flavor of Sundal?

To enhance flavor, use fresh, high-quality spices, and consider adding a squeeze of lime juice before serving. This adds a zesty note that balances the dish's richness.
